Geology Hike

Event Details

Geologist John Johnston will lead this 2-mile hike identifying rocks and explaining how they were formed. There will be a visit down into the ruins of the Civil War-era New Manchester Mill alongside the lovely rapids of Sweetwater Creek (up to class IV) Pre-registration is needed as space will be limited to 9 and social distancing will be required.

The tectonic events that forced the rock units to be faulted and folded will also be discussed. Sturdy, closed-toe shoes are required. Meet in front of the Visitors Center.
